California's varied climate presents unique challenges for garage doors. Inland areas experience extreme heat, requiring materials that resist warping and fading, while coastal regions face salt spray and humidity, demanding corrosion-resistant components. Our installations consider these factors, selecting durable materials that maintain aesthetic appeal and operational integrity across California's diverse weather patterns. We ensure your garage door functions reliably during hot summers and mild, wet winters.

Due to the significant tension and potential for serious injury, fixing a garage door spring by yourself in California is not recommended. Professional technicians have the specialized tools and knowledge to safely handle spring repairs. Prioritize your safety and contact us for expert service.
The average lifespan of a garage door spring in California typically falls between 7 to 15 years, influenced by usage and environmental exposure. Frequent use or exposure to harsh coastal air can shorten this duration. Regular inspections help predict and manage potential failures.
